Centerville, Bennett County advance to Class ‘B’ semis

HURON, S.D. (KELO) — The Class ‘B’ girls basketball state tournament has been narrowed down from eight teams to four following the quarterfinals on Thursday.

Top-seed and reigning state champion Centerville defeated Deubrook Area 51-46 in the first game of the day. Freshman Izzy Eide led all scorers with 22 points for the Tornadoes.

Bennett County eeked out a 51-49 win over Parkston. Peyson O’Neill led the way with 14 points in the win.

Dell Rapids St. Mary’s defeated Harding County 61-50 to move onto the semis. Madala Hanson paced the Cardinals with 22 points.

In the final game of the day, Sanborn Central/Woonsocket topped Lyman 53-40. Liz Boschee netted 23 for the Blackhawks.

The semifinals will see Centerville meet Bennett County and Dell Rapids St. Mary’s take on Sanborn Central/Woonsocket on Friday.
